Real Wedding: St. Louis, Missouri


I always live it when a bride commits to a bold color palette, so Kerri & Jason's orange and pink color combination was an instant favorite! The couple originally wanted to be married at the World's Fair Pavilion, but when the venue was booked they incorporated the vibe they wanted to achieve into a new space. During the reception Kerri's was surprised by a phone call from her sister, who was at home on bed rest and about to have a baby. The DJ put the call on speaker phone and by the time the conversation was through there wasn't a dry eye in the house - such a sweet moment!
